1,范圍查詢,例如
Term?begin=new?Term("publishdate","1999-01-01");
Term?end=new?Term?("publishdate","1999-10-15");
RangeQuery?q=new?RangeQuery(begin,end,true);
1),
Lucene-2.2.0 源代碼閱讀學習
2)
Lucene 中自定義排序的實現
3)
lucene學習筆記
4)
http://www.lucene.com.cn/sj.htm
5)LRU
LRU(最近最少使用算法) and MRU(最近最常使用算法)? 所謂的LRU(Least recently used)算法的基本概念是:當內存的剩余的可用空間不夠時,緩沖區盡可能的先保留使用者最常使用的數據,換句話說就是優先清除”較不常使用的數據”,并釋放其空間.之所以”較不常使用的數據”要用引號是因為這里判斷所謂的較不常使用的標準是人為的、不嚴格的.所謂的MRU(Most recently used)算法的意義正好和LRU算法相反.
oracle緩存用到了LRU
http://bluepopopo.javaeye.com/blog/180236
6,Apache lucene知識匯集
7,Lucene 2.3.1 閱讀學習(41)
8,Lucene的score()實現
9,Lucene 的排序修改
10,6大原因讓你不選擇使用Lucene
11,解決lucene范圍搜索中的TooManyClauses exception
Term?begin=new?Term("publishdate","1999-01-01");
Term?end=new?Term?("publishdate","1999-10-15");
RangeQuery?q=new?RangeQuery(begin,end,true);
1),
Lucene-2.2.0 源代碼閱讀學習
2)
Lucene 中自定義排序的實現
3)
lucene學習筆記
4)
http://www.lucene.com.cn/sj.htm
5)LRU
LRU(最近最少使用算法) and MRU(最近最常使用算法)? 所謂的LRU(Least recently used)算法的基本概念是:當內存的剩余的可用空間不夠時,緩沖區盡可能的先保留使用者最常使用的數據,換句話說就是優先清除”較不常使用的數據”,并釋放其空間.之所以”較不常使用的數據”要用引號是因為這里判斷所謂的較不常使用的標準是人為的、不嚴格的.所謂的MRU(Most recently used)算法的意義正好和LRU算法相反.
oracle緩存用到了LRU
http://bluepopopo.javaeye.com/blog/180236
6,Apache lucene知識匯集
7,Lucene 2.3.1 閱讀學習(41)
8,Lucene的score()實現
9,Lucene 的排序修改
10,6大原因讓你不選擇使用Lucene
11,解決lucene范圍搜索中的TooManyClauses exception